数据库
【2023年】河北省沧州市全国计算机等级考试数据库技术真题(含答案...
【2023年】河北省沧州市全国计算机等级考试数据库技术真题(含答案)学校:________ 班级:________ 姓名:________ 考号:________一、1.选择题(10题)1. 当一个事务执行期间所使用的数据,不能被第二个事务再使用,直到第一个事务结束为止。这个性质称为事务的A.串行性 B.隔离性 C.永久性 D.原子性 2. 一个关系数据库文件中的各条记录A.前后顺序不能...
数据库查询 逗号分隔字段
字符串截取逗号数据库查询 逗号分隔字段数据库查询逗号分隔字段是一种常见的查询需求,用于检索在数据库表中某个字段中包含指定逗号分隔值的记录。在进行这种查询时,首先需要使用SELECT语句选择要查询的表和字段。然后,使用WHERE子句来指定字段中包含指定逗号分隔值的条件。例如,假设我们有一个名为"employees"的员工表,其中的“skills”字段保存了每个员工所拥有的技能,多个技能之间使用逗号进...
数据库 函数
数据库 函数 数据库函数,顾名思义,是用来对数据库进行操作的函数。数据库函数可以实现对数据库中存储的数据进行查询、统计、计算等操作。它们可以与SQL语句配合使用,也可以被视为一种自定义的SQL函数。 在数据库函数中,常用的函数有以下几类: 1. 聚合函数:字符串截取拼接 聚合函数是指对某个数据集...
2023年卫生招聘考试之卫生招聘(计算机信息管理)模考预测题库(夺冠系列...
2023年卫生招聘考试之卫生招聘(计算机信息管理)模考预测题库(夺冠系列)单选题(共40题)1、以下叙述中正确的是( )A.构成C++语言程序的基本单位是类B.可以在一个函数中定义另一个函数C.main()函数必须放在其他函数之前D.所有被调用的函数一定要在调用 之前进行定义【答案】 A2、下列关于自由表的说法中,错误的是A.在没有打开数据库的情况下所建立的数据表,就是自由表B.自由表不属于任何一...
java实现字符串数字部分自增
java实现字符串数字部分⾃增实现添加员⼯时对⼯号进⾏⾃增长思路:后台获取数据库中最后⼀条员⼯数据的⼯号,对其进⾏⾃增再传⼊前端mybatis映射⽂件:获取最后⼀条数据1 <select id="getLastNo" resultType="string">23 SELECT no from t_staff ORDER BY no DESC LIMIT 0,1...
加盐哈希算法
加盐哈希算法加盐哈希算法是一种用于增强密码存储安全性的技术。它在密码的基础上添加了“盐”,使得相同密码在存储过程中生成不同的哈希值。本文将详细介绍加盐哈希算法的原理、应用场景以及使用方法,旨在帮助读者更好地理解和应用这一技术。首先,让我们来了解加盐哈希算法的原理。哈希算法是一种将任意长度的输入数据转化为固定长度哈希值的技术。它以一种单向的方式对数据进行加密,使得无法通过哈希值逆向推导出原始数据。常...
sql公式(一)
sql公式(一)SQL公式:简介与示例1. 概述SQL(Structured Query Language)是一种用于管理关系型数据库的语言。在SQL中,公式是一种用来进行计算和生成新值的表达式。SQL公式常用于SELECT语句中的列部分和WHERE语句中的条件部分。2. 字符串公式字符串公式用于操作和处理文本数据。•CONCAT():用于将两个或多个字符串连接在一起。 示例: SELECT CO...
sqlserver14位字符串yyyyMMddHHmmss格式转换为日期格式
sqlserver14位字符串yyyyMMddHHmmss格式转换为⽇期格式数据库中字段是字符型,值格式为yyyyMMddHHmmss,要将⽇期减少40秒,下⾯是具体的sql语句第⼀步、将字符型转为⽇期型select convert(datetime,substring(left(MMS_SendTime,8)+' ' + substring(MMS_SendTime,9,2)+':' + sub...
一些计算化学相关的免费的在线数据库
一些计算化学相关的免费的在线数据库、分子结构库及工具1 在线信息数据库部分字符串截取在线ChemSpider小分子信息整合数据库:www.chemspider简介:是当前众多的在线分子数据库的信息整合,便于用户搜索,数据来自200种数据库。根据分子俗名、系统命名、Smile/InChI字符串、注册号、分子式等方式搜索,会列出分子平面结构、实验测定和实时估算的理化性质(含Log...
大数据工具导论试题答案
大数据工具导论第一章2011年麦肯锡研究院提出的大数据定义是:大数据是指其大小超出了常规数据库工具获取、储存、管理和( )能力的数据集。 A.计算 B.应用 C.分析 D.访问用4V来概括大数据的特点的话,一般是指:Value、Velocity、Volume和( )。 A.Vainly B.Variety C.Vagary D.Valley大数据分析四个方面的工作主要是:数...
数据库连接失败的常见原因及解决办法
数据库连接失败的常见原因及解决办法数据库连接是许多应用程序和系统的核心组成部分,当连接失败时,将对应用程序的正常运行产生负面影响。因此,了解数据库连接失败的常见原因以及相应的解决办法对于维护和优化系统具有重要意义。本文将介绍一些常见的数据库连接失败原因,并提供相应的解决办法,以帮助读者更好地应对这些问题。1. 网络问题数据库连接失败的最常见原因之一是网络问题。网络故障、路由器问题以及防火墙配置错误...
命令行shell用于SQLite
命令⾏shell⽤于SQLite转SQLite 库包含了⼀个简单的命令⾏实⽤⼯具命名sqlite3 (或sqlite3exe 在windows 上), 它允许⽤户⼿动输⼊并执⾏SQL 命令针对⼀个SQLite 数据库此⽂档提供了有关如何使⽤简要介绍sqlite3 程序使⽤⼊门要启动"sqlite3 程序时, 只需键⼊"sqlite3 ", 后跟该⽂件SQLite , 该数据库如果该⽂件不存在, 则...
R语言-如何截取变量中指定位置的若干个字符
R语⾔-如何截取变量中指定位置的若⼲个字符例如,某数据库如下,需要把第⼆个变量⾥⾯的ID号码(格式为T-20-252-02)提取出来作为⼀个新变量。命令如下:b=readWorksheetFromFile(temp[11],sheet=1)读⼊excel数据,命名为数据库b,这⾥temp[11]是读⼊temp中第11个⽂件名对应的⽂件attach(b)attach数据库,之后即可直接⽤变量名fil...
【转】MySQL和SqlServer的sql语句区别
【转】MySQL和SqlServer的sql语句区别1、⾃增长列的插⼊SQLServer中可以不为⾃动增长列插⼊值MySQL中需要为⾃动增长列插⼊值。2、获取当前时间函数SQLServer写法:getdate()MySQL写法:now()3、从数据库定位到表SQLServer写法:库名.dbo.表名;或者:库名..表名(注:中间使⽤两个点)select password from Info.dbo...
SQL SERVER函数大全
SQL SERVER命令大全SQLServer和Oracle的常用函数对比1.绝对值 S:select abs(-1) valueO:select abs(-1) value from dual2.取整(大) S:select ceiling(-1.001) value O:select ceil(-1.001) value from dual3.取整(小) 字符串截取 sqlS:select f...
MySQL手注之布尔盲注
MySQL⼿注之布尔盲注⼀、什么是布尔盲注? 在传参数的时候页⾯只返回两种情况,显位什么的都没有,这种时候就要去⽤Yes or No 去猜⼀猜数据,注意运⽤⼆分法⼆、盲注常⽤的函数? Length(),返回字符串的长度 ASCII(),返回字符的ASCII码值 substr(str, sta,x),截取字符串。其中str为需要截取的字符串,sta表⽰...
sql盲注讲解
sql盲注讲解盲注有时候,开发⼈员不会把数据库报错信息显⽰在前端页⾯,这样就使我们想要通过union注⼊或报错注⼊的攻击⽅式难以实现。当不显⽰报错信息的时候,我们还可以通过盲注的⽅式来对数据库进⾏注⼊攻击。盲注,顾名思义,就是在页⾯没有提供明显信息的情况执⾏的注⼊⽅式。盲注⼜分为两种,布尔型盲注和时间型盲注。布尔型盲注,以sqli-lab第8关为例:1、输⼊id=1正常显⽰,输⼊id=123456...
MySQL与Oracle的语法区别详细对比
MySQL与Oracle的语法区别详细对⽐Oracle和mysql的⼀些简单命令对⽐1) SQL> select to_char(sysdate,'yyyy-mm-dd') from dual; SQL> select to_char(sysdate,'hh24-mi-ss') from dual; mysql> select date_format(no...
SQLServer作业
第六章预习作业✓第六章单词✓第六章课后选择题✓书写第六章的预习笔记✓问答题:从指定字符串中截取部分字符串应该使用String的什么方法?Parse与Convert两种类型转换的区别?数据完整性指的是什么?SQL Server有哪两种身份验证方式?创建数据库需要指定哪两种文件?课后作业✓课堂练习(重做)✓书面作业:第六章的总结✓课后简答题:第2题✓问答题:与使用文件保存数据相比较,使用数据库来保存数...
sql 通用拆分写法 -回复
sql 通用拆分写法 -回复SQL通用拆分写法在日常的数据库操作中,我们经常需要对数据进行拆分操作,以满足特定的需求。无论是从一个表拆分出多个表,还是将一个字段拆分为多个字段,SQL拆分写法可以帮助我们实现这一目标。本文将介绍一种通用的SQL拆分写法,并逐步回答相关问题。一、什么是SQL通用拆分写法?SQL通用拆分写法是一种灵活、通用的数据库操作技术,能够将一个表或一个字段拆分成多个表或字段。通过...
sql查数据库中某字符串所在的表及字段
sql查数据库中某字符串所在的表及字段declare@str varchar(100)set@str='是否严格控制'--要搜索的字符串declare@s varchar(8000)declare tb cursor local forselect s='if exists(select 1&nbs...
SQL语句中截取字符串Substr
SQL语句中截取字符串Substr 不同的数据库中提供的函数不同:Oracle数据库提供的截取字符串函数是:Substr字符串截取 sqlsubstr(stirng1,strat,length);截取功能;解析⼀下:string1是你要截取的字符串,strat是要开始截取的位置,length是你要截取多少个字符串。在Access数据库中截取字符串采⽤:Left、Right、Mid三个函数可以进⾏:...
Sql中的left函数、right函数
Sql中的left函数、right函数DB2中left()函数和right()函数对应oracle中的substr()函数 DB2 LEFT、RIGHT函数语法:LEFT(ARG,LENGTH)、RIGHT(ARG,LENGTH)LEFT、RIGHT函数返回ARG最左边、右边的LENGTH个字符串,ARG可以是CHAR或BINARY STRING。eg:SELECT LEFT(NAME,2),RI...
SQL注入截取字符串常用函数(转)
SQL注⼊截取字符串常⽤函数(转)在sql注⼊中,往往会⽤到截取字符串的问题,例如不回显的情况下进⾏的注⼊,也成为盲注,这种情况下往往需要⼀个⼀个字符的去猜解,过程中需要⽤到截取字符串。本⽂中主要列举三个函数和该函数注⼊过程中的⼀些⽤例。Ps;此处⽤mysql进⾏说明,其他类型数据库请⾃⾏检测。三⼤法宝:mid(),substr(),left()(1)mid()函数此函数为截取字符串⼀部分。MID...
一个逗号引发的数据库异常的思考
一个逗号引发的数据库异常的思考 之所以写这篇文章,完全是纪念我这无聊而又让我深思的一天。 昨天晚上,收到王师兄一个电话,说学报网站出问题了,发布新闻发不上去。我当时还想,开什么国际玩笑,我去年曾反复测试过了,怎么会有问题呢,然后我把他那篇新闻拿过来上传,发现果然如他所说,点击“提交”时页面没有反应,一片空白。 就这样看似...
oracle 逗号分隔 转译
oracle 逗号分隔 转译Oracle是一种关系型数据库管理系统(RDBMS),它是由Oracle公司开发的。Oracle数据库使用SQL语言进行数据管理和查询。逗号分隔(CSV)是一种常见的文件格式,用于存储和传输数据。转译是将一个字符序列转换为另一个字符序列的过程。一、Oracle数据库1.1 什么是关系型数据库管理系统?关系型数据库管理系统(RDBMS)是一种用于管理和组织数据的软件系统。...
数据库连接池概况与关键部分-数据库理论论文-计算机论文
数据库连接池概况与关键部分-数据库理论论文-计算机论文——文章均为WORD文档,下载后可直接编辑使用亦可打印——一、数据库连接池基本概念及工作原理数据库连接池作为一种将链接作为资源管理的实体,此资源就是数据库的连接。连接池的基本思想就是预先设立一部分放置于内存中的固定对象以备使用。而建立一个数据库连接池,就可将链接发过去进行查询,从而来获取结果。一个链接在生命周期内所能处理的查询数据是没有限制的,...
智慧树答案数据库原理及应用(山东联盟)知到课后答案章节测试2022年_百 ...
第一章1.数据库(DB)、数据库系统(DBS)、数据库管理系统(DBMS)之间的关系是( )。答案:没有任何关系2.数据库系统的核心和基础是( )。答案:逻辑模型3.数据库系统的三级模式结构中,下列属于三级模式的是( )。答案:外模式;抽象模式;概念模式4.一个数据库系统的外模式只能有一个。( )答案:对5.在数据库中,数据的物理独立性是指应用程序与数据库中数据的逻辑结果相互独立。( )答案:错第...
(2022年)山东省聊城市全国计算机等级考试数据库技术测试卷(含答案...
(2022年)山东省聊城市全国计算机等级考试数据库技术测试卷(含答案)学校:________ 班级:________ 姓名:________ 考号:________一、1.选择题(10题)1.计算机病毒是指能够侵入计算机系统并在计算机系统中潜伏、传播、破坏系统正常工作的一种具有繁殖能力的( )。A.指令 B.文件 C.信号 D.程序 2. 在一棵二叉树上,度为零的节点的个数为n0,度为2...
为什么String类是不可变的?
为什么String类是不可变的?为什么String类是不可变的?#String类什么是 当满⾜以下条件时,对象才是不可变的:对象创建以后其状态就不能修改。。对象是正确创建的(在对象的创建期间,this引⽤没有逸出)。 这是《Java并发编程实战》⼀书中的定义。在书中,说明并不是⼀定要将所有的域都设为final类型,⽐如String类就是这种情况,String 会将散列值的计...